
JS基础笔记
programmer_trip
这个作者很懒,什么都没留下…
展开
-
用JS实现对栈的操作
用JS实现对栈的操作栈的结构:栈底、栈顶(栈是一种后入先出的结构)栈的操作:入栈、出栈栈的方法:push //栈顶添加元素pop // 拿出栈顶元素peek // 查看栈顶元素isEmpty // 检查栈是否为空clear // 移除栈的全部元素size //获取栈的长度下面通过Js模拟对于栈的操作,对栈有一个比较直观的感受构造一个...原创 2019-12-29 16:44:26 · 857 阅读 · 0 评论 -
JS中计时器setTimeout以及setInterval的使用以及for循环中延迟打印的坑
JS中的函数使用一、setTimeout:格式:var intervalID = scope.setTimeout(function[, delay, param1, param2, ...]) // 参数在延时时间到达后,将作为该函数的传参,但是在不同浏览器存在兼容性问题,若需使用需做兼容性处理,具体参考链接1var intervalID = scope.setTimeout(funct...原创 2019-12-07 20:20:00 · 1718 阅读 · 0 评论 -
JS基础笔记之循环语句
JS基础笔记之循环语句一、JS中循环语句有三种:for循环,while,以及do…while1、for循环格式:语句1为循环开始前执行的语句,通常为某一变量的初始化赋值语句, 用来给循环控制变量赋初值;语句2为循环条件表达式,条件成立则进入循环;语句3为每次执行循环语句后执行的表达式,语句3执行后,再次判断条件表达式是否成立,成立则再次执行循环语句,否则退出循环。整个for循环执行顺序为 ...原创 2019-12-04 21:15:34 · 376 阅读 · 0 评论 -
JS基础笔记之js代码在HTML中的使用方式
JS基础笔记之js代码在HTML中的使用方式必须放在<script>与</script>标签之间若使用外部javascript,则需新建一个扩展名为.js文件,然后在<script>标签的src属性中注明js文件的路径,外部js文件通常包含被多个网页使用的代码使用外部js文件代码实践:利用js输出HTML内容若不使用js外部文件时:<!DO...原创 2019-12-01 11:05:54 · 348 阅读 · 0 评论 -
JS基础笔记之JS主要用途
JS基础笔记之JS主要用途js的主要用途介绍1、写入HTML输出2、对事件做出反应3、改变HTML内容4、改变HTML图像5、改变HTML样式6、验证输入代码实践:1、写入HTML输出<!DOCTYPE html><html><head><meta charset="UTF-8"><title></tit...原创 2019-11-30 21:26:05 · 525 阅读 · 0 评论